The Unseen Advantage: Polyester Fibre Construction
The core of this cable puller is its
polyester fibre composition, specifically a trilobal line design. This material choice is not arbitrary; it directly addresses several long-standing challenges in electrical and telecommunication installations. The fibre exhibits a high tensile strength, allowing it to withstand considerable pulling forces without snapping. This is crucial for navigating long runs or conduits with multiple bends.
Unlike traditional steel fish tapes that can be prone to kinking or rusting over time, the polyester fibre maintains its structural integrity. It resists corrosion, a significant advantage when working in damp environments or conduits that may accumulate moisture. This material also offers a degree of flexibility that rigid steel cannot match, making it adept at traversing tight corners and intricate pathways within walls and ceilings. It bends where steel struggles.
Compared to older, flat steel tapes, the round, trilobal profile of this line significantly reduces friction against the inner walls of a conduit. This design minimizes the effort required to push the line through, especially over extended distances. The smooth surface ensures that the conduit itself remains undamaged, preventing potential future issues like cable chafing or insulation degradation. This is a key differentiator.

Safety and Compliance: Protecting Installations
As a certified electrician, the integrity of an electrical installation is paramount. This cable puller, by facilitating smooth and undamaged cable routing, plays a subtle yet critical role in maintaining safety standards. Preventing kinks, abrasions, or excessive force on cables during installation directly reduces the risk of future electrical faults. Damaged insulation can lead to short circuits.
The smooth passage of cables through conduits, enabled by this tool, helps ensure that wires are not chafed or stressed. Chafed insulation can compromise the dielectric strength of the cable, potentially leading to arcing, overheating, and ultimately, electrical fires. By minimizing these risks, the tool contributes to installations that comply with safety regulations and reduce long-term maintenance issues. Safety is non-negotiable.
